Just picked up a Streamlight Polytac HP and considering buying a VLTOR Offset Scout to be able to move it around easier.

I currently have a VTAC that I like since it sticks the light out at 9 o'clock when mounted to the top of the rail (which drops the HP bezel out of the way of the sight picture) and was curious if the VLTOR has this orientation or more of the slightly angled up approach some mounts use(I have a Blackhawk that hold it at 10-11 o'clock) which gets the HP bezel in the way of the view somewhat.

Also, is there any issue with the VLTOR being not offset far enough with the bezel size of the HP since I am using it with standard front sights?
